Diglycerol is a derivative of glycerol, synthesized to create a molecule with enhanced humectant properties. This means it is exceptionally good at attracting and retaining moisture, providing deep and long-lasting hydration to the skin. Unlike monoglycerols, Diglycerol's structure allows it to bind more water molecules, leading to more effective moisturization. For skincare products, this translates to improved skin suppleness, a smoother feel, and a reduction in the appearance of dry, flaky skin. The benefits of Diglycerol are not limited to its humectant capabilities. It also plays a crucial role in improving the texture and application experience of skincare products. It can enhance the spreadability of creams and lotions, making them easier to apply and absorb. Furthermore, Diglycerol can contribute to a desirable skin feel – one that is smooth, soft, and non-greasy. This is particularly important for products like facial moisturizers and serums, where the initial feel upon application is a key factor in consumer satisfaction.
Moreover, Diglycerol is known for its low irritation potential, making it suitable for a wide range of skincare products, including those formulated for sensitive skin. Its mildness can also help to buffer the potential irritation from other active ingredients, allowing for the creation of more sophisticated and efficacious formulations that are still gentle on the skin. The typical recommended dosage for Diglycerol in cosmetic formulations is between 0.5% and 2.0%, allowing for effective use without significantly increasing formulation complexity or cost.
